Our Audit & Oversight Process

Onboarding & Scope Set. Review contract, drawings, schedule, pay app structure, and risk priorities.
Baseline Audit. Site safety & controls, quality benchmarks, long-lead & procurement status, submittals & permits.
Routine Site Visits. Scheduled walkthroughs with photo logs, deficiency lists, test/inspection verification.
Commercial Review. Validate progress vs. pay applications, holdbacks, COs, allowances, and cash flow forecasts.
Reporting & Follow-Up. Issue prioritized report; track closures, re-inspect high-risk items, advise on remedies.
Closeout Audit. Substantial performance, O&M/manuals, warranties, training, and occupancy conditions.

Inspection Type When Who’s Present What You Receive
Excavation & Foundations Structural Pre-pour & post-pour GC/CM, forming crew, our inspector Rebar/photos, layout checks, pour log; deficiencies w/ remedies
Framing & Shear/Strap Structural Before sheathing/insulation Framers, GC/CM, our inspector Framing checklist, fastener patterns, shear/blocking photos
Mechanical/Electrical/Plumbing Rough-In MEP Prior to cover HVAC, electrical, plumbing/gas trades Rough-in photos, labeling, test results, panel/sizing notes
Air/Vapour/Water Barrier Envelope Before cladding & insulation Envelope trade, GC/CM, our inspector Detail photos (penetrations, tapes, flashings), punch list
Insulation & Sound Control Energy Pre-drywall Insulation trade, GC/CM R-value/coverage checks, thermal bridge notes, photos
Blower Door / Airtightness Testing Pre-boarding or at lock-up Testing tech, GC/CM, our inspector Test report, leakage locations, remediation plan
Finishes & Systems Startup QC Prior to substantial performance GC/CM, key trades, our inspector Deficiency register (RAG), commissioning snapshots, training log
Final & Occupancy Readiness Closeout Pre-final & post-final GC/CM, owner rep, our inspector Closeout checklist, warranty items, photo archive & sign-off

Construction Audit & Oversight — FAQs

Are you independent from the general contractor and trades?

Yes. We’re retained by and report to the owner/lender/strata only. We do not hold contracts with the GC or trades on oversight engagements.

Will oversight delay the project?

No—our cadence aligns with existing milestones and meetings. Findings are concise and action-oriented to support momentum, not block it.

What documents do you need to start?

Executed contract, current drawings/specs, schedule, submittal log, latest pay app, CO log, and permits. We’ll issue a short request list at kickoff.

Do you review pay applications and holdbacks?

Yes. We validate claimed progress vs. observed work, holdback compliance, approved COs, and allowances; we flag discrepancies with photos and quantities where applicable.

Can you testify or support dispute resolution?

We provide factual records and expert input suitable for negotiation or, if required, formal proceedings. Scope and rates for dispute work are agreed in advance.
